Sonia Gandhi will choose the next Punjab Chief Minister after the elections, claims Harish Rawat

Harish Rawat, the Congress general secretary in charge of Punjab, stated on Monday that there is no animosity between Chief Minister Charanjit Singh Channi and the PCC Chief Navjot Singh Sidhu. He also said that the two will work together to win the 2022 elections.

“The Chief minister and Mr Sidhu will work together on everything. They’ll be collaborating to win the next election.” Rawat, who was in New Delhi today for the joining of Uttrakhand transport minister Yashpal Arya in the Congress, stated, “The Congress President will then select who the next CM would be.”

Sidhu resigned as President of the Punjab Congress on September 28 and shared his resignation letter on Twitter.

On Monday, Rawat stated unequivocally that his resignation had been rejected.

Rawat said any difficulties between the chief minister and Sidhu, who skipped the former’s son’s wedding in Chandigarh on Monday, will be addressed inside the party.
